分类:架构师

数据结构绪论-逻辑结构与物理结构

2017-02-22 smile_from_2015 0℃

按照视点的不同 , 我们把数据结构分为逻辑结构和物理结构。 1.5 . 1 逻辑结构 逻辑结构:是指数据对象中数据元素之间的相互关系。其实这也是我们今后最需要关注的问题。 逻辑结构分为以下四种 : 1...

数据结构绪论-基本概念和术语

2017-02-22 smile_from_2015 0℃

程序设计 = 鼓据结构+算法 说到数据结构是什么,我们得先来谈谈什么叫数据。正所谓"巧妇难为无米之炊',再强大的计算机,也是要有"米'下锅才可以干活的,否则就是一堆破铜烂铁。 这个"米"就是数据。 1...

Zookeeper序列化及通信协议

2017-02-22 LW_GHY 0℃

一、Jute   Jute是Zookeeper底层序列化组件,其用于Zookeeper进行网络数据传输和本地磁盘数据存储的序列化和反序列化工作。   2.1 Jute序列化     MockRe...

Java实现括号匹配校验

2017-02-22 smile_from_2015 0℃

检测括号是否匹配的方法可用“期待的急迫程度”这个概念来描述。 /** * 括号匹配校验 * [ ( [ ] [ ] ) ] * 1 2 3 4 5 6 7 8 */ public class...

JAVABEAN EJB POJO区别

2017-02-22 qq_17344293 0℃

1、POJO     POJO(Plain Old Java Object)这种叫法是Martin Fowler、Rebecca Parsons和Josh MacKenzie在2000年的一次演...

Java递归求解汉诺塔问题

2017-02-22 smile_from_2015 0℃

汉诺塔问题 规则: 1.每次只能移动一个圆盘。 2.圆盘可以插在X,Y,Z中的任一塔座上。 3.任何时刻都不能让一个大的圆盘落在小的圆盘上面。 算法: 1.当X塔只有1个盘子时,将编号为1的圆盘从X...

Atitit http2 新特性

2017-02-22 attilax 0℃

Atitit http2 新特性     性能 安全与push Multipexing 多路复用 每个 Frame Header 都有一个 Stream ID 就是被用于实现该特性。每次请求...

Atitti html5 h5 新特性attilax总结

2017-02-22 attilax 0℃

Atitti html5 h5 新特性attilax总结   Attilax觉得不错的新特性 3.语义Header和Footer (The Semantic Header and Foote...

Zookeeper源码分析之请求处理链

2017-02-22 LW_GHY 0℃

一、总体框图   对于请求处理链而言,所有请求处理器的父接口为RequestProcessor,其框架图如下 说明:   AckRequestProcessor,将前一阶段的请求...

Flink运行时之生成作业图

2017-02-22 yanghua_kobe 0℃

生成作业图在分析完了流处理程序生成的流图(StreamGraph)以及批处理程序生成的优化后的计划(OptimizedPlan)之后,下一步就是生成它们面向Flink运行时执行引擎的共同抽象——作业图...

《JAVA与模式》之门面模式

2017-02-22 heiyueya 0℃

转载-http://www.cnblogs.com/java-my-life/archive/2012/05/02/2478101.html 在阎宏博士的《JAVA与模式》一书中开头是这样描述门面...

Zookeeper请求处理

2017-02-22 LW_GHY 0℃

一、请求处理   1.1 会话创建请求   Zookeeper服务端对于会话创建的处理,大体可以分为请求接收、会话创建、预处理、事务处理、事务应用和会话响应六大环节,其大体流程如 ...

linux可执行程序如何在系统后台运行

2017-02-22 faihung 0℃

我们经常会碰到这样的问题,用 telnet/ssh 登录了远程的 Linux 服务器,运行了一些耗时较长的任务, 结果却由于网络的不稳定导致任务中途失败。如何让命令提交后不受本地关闭终端窗口/网络断开...

Zookeeper的Leader选举

2017-02-22 LW_GHY 0℃

一、前言   前面学习了Zookeeper服务端的相关细节,其中对于集群启动而言,很重要的一部分就是Leader选举,接着就开始深入学习Leader选举。 二、Leader选举   ...

Zookeeper应用场景

2017-02-22 LW_GHY 0℃

一、前言   Zookeeper的应用场景。 二、典型应用场景   Zookeeper是一个高可用的分布式数据管理和协调框架,并且能够很好的保证分布式环境中数据的一致性。在越来越多的...

Zookeeper与Paxos

2017-02-22 LW_GHY 0℃

一、前言   Paxos在开源软件Zookeeper中的应用。 二、Zookeeper   Zookeeper是一个开源的分布式协调服务,其设计目标是将那些复杂的且容易出错的分布式一...

Zookeeper源码分析之Watcher机制(一)

2017-02-22 LW_GHY 0℃

一、前言   分析Zookeeper中的Watcher机制所涉及到的类。 二、总体框图   对于Watcher机制而言,主要涉及的类主要如下。   说明:   Wat...

struts2框架中action链传递时的参数问题

2017-02-22 szc889988 0℃

1.首先需要了解struts.xml文件中的result标签有几种放回结果类型: 此处type的值为chain时意味着这个result不是显示一个jsp页面,而是把这个action传递给下一...